truecharts / public

Community Helm Chart Repository
https://truecharts.org
GNU Affero General Public License v3.0
1.14k stars 617 forks source link

Unmanic unable to scan library. #2278

Closed git4unrealnondev closed 2 years ago

git4unrealnondev commented 2 years ago

App Name

Unmanic

SCALE Version

22.02.0

App Version

0.2.0_2.0.3

Application Events

2022-03-24 20:32:14
Started container unmanic
2022-03-24 20:32:13
Created container unmanic
2022-03-24 20:32:07
Container image "tccr.io/truecharts/unmanic:v0.2.0@sha256:8803a54504f699d45197b51866e9bdbb1f7bd543e0183aa8c055bfb3dacef04f" already present on machine
2022-03-24 20:32:06
Started container hostpatch
2022-03-24 20:32:04
Created container hostpatch
2022-03-24 20:31:58
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:31:56
Started container autopermissions
2022-03-24 20:31:56
Created container autopermissions
2022-03-24 20:31:49
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:31:49
Add eth0 [172.16.0.162/16] from ix-net
Successfully assigned ix-unmanic/unmanic-755d7d574d-79bws to ix-truenas
2022-03-24 20:31:37
Created pod: unmanic-755d7d574d-79bws
2022-03-24 20:31:37
Scaled up replica set unmanic-755d7d574d to 1
2022-03-24 20:31:30
Liveness probe failed: dial tcp 172.16.0.161:8888: connect: connection refused
2022-03-24 20:31:30
Readiness probe failed: dial tcp 172.16.0.161:8888: connect: connection refused
2022-03-24 20:31:24
Stopping container unmanic
2022-03-24 20:31:24
Deleted pod: unmanic-57968596-vmq88
2022-03-24 20:31:24
Scaled down replica set unmanic-57968596 to 0
2022-03-24 20:07:35
Started container unmanic
2022-03-24 20:07:35
Created container unmanic
2022-03-24 20:07:23
Container image "tccr.io/truecharts/unmanic:v0.2.0@sha256:8803a54504f699d45197b51866e9bdbb1f7bd543e0183aa8c055bfb3dacef04f" already present on machine
2022-03-24 20:07:21
Started container hostpatch
2022-03-24 20:07:20
Created container hostpatch
2022-03-24 20:07:07
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:07:05
Started container autopermissions
2022-03-24 20:07:05
Created container autopermissions
2022-03-24 20:06:53
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:06:53
Add eth0 [172.16.0.161/16] from ix-net
Successfully assigned ix-unmanic/unmanic-57968596-vmq88 to ix-truenas
2022-03-24 20:06:40
Created pod: unmanic-57968596-vmq88
2022-03-24 20:06:40
Scaled up replica set unmanic-57968596 to 1
2022-03-24 20:06:32
Error: failed to start container "unmanic": Error response from daemon: cannot join network of a non running container: cb9158cb96f46bb2349a7482e23a1fada190d53d556963c83cd56f0f18737fb7
2022-03-24 20:06:31
Created container unmanic
2022-03-24 20:06:19
Container image "tccr.io/truecharts/unmanic:v0.2.0@sha256:8803a54504f699d45197b51866e9bdbb1f7bd543e0183aa8c055bfb3dacef04f" already present on machine
2022-03-24 20:06:19
Deleted pod: unmanic-64dd9c68fd-b7l54
2022-03-24 20:06:19
Scaled down replica set unmanic-64dd9c68fd to 0
2022-03-24 20:06:18
Started container hostpatch
2022-03-24 20:06:16
Created container hostpatch
2022-03-24 20:06:05
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:06:04
Started container autopermissions
2022-03-24 20:06:02
Created container autopermissions
2022-03-24 20:05:50
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 20:05:50
Add eth0 [172.16.0.160/16] from ix-net
2022-03-24 20:05:35
Created pod: unmanic-64dd9c68fd-b7l54
Successfully assigned ix-unmanic/unmanic-64dd9c68fd-b7l54 to ix-truenas
2022-03-24 20:05:35
Scaled up replica set unmanic-64dd9c68fd to 1
2022-03-24 20:05:29
Liveness probe failed: dial tcp 172.16.0.159:8888: connect: connection refused
2022-03-24 20:05:29
Readiness probe failed: dial tcp 172.16.0.159:8888: connect: connection refused
2022-03-24 20:05:24
Stopping container unmanic
2022-03-24 20:05:24
Deleted pod: unmanic-678468fdd9-qkmw7
2022-03-24 20:05:24
Scaled down replica set unmanic-678468fdd9 to 0
2022-03-24 19:59:13
Started container unmanic
2022-03-24 19:59:13
Created container unmanic
2022-03-24 19:59:04
Successfully pulled image "tccr.io/truecharts/unmanic:v0.2.0@sha256:8803a54504f699d45197b51866e9bdbb1f7bd543e0183aa8c055bfb3dacef04f" in 6m11.709430858s
2022-03-24 19:52:53
Pulling image "tccr.io/truecharts/unmanic:v0.2.0@sha256:8803a54504f699d45197b51866e9bdbb1f7bd543e0183aa8c055bfb3dacef04f"
2022-03-24 19:52:52
Started container hostpatch
2022-03-24 19:52:50
Created container hostpatch
2022-03-24 19:52:43
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 19:52:41
Started container autopermissions
2022-03-24 19:52:41
Created container autopermissions
2022-03-24 19:52:34
Container image "ghcr.io/truecharts/alpine:v3.14.2@sha256:4095394abbae907e94b1f2fd2e2de6c4f201a5b9704573243ca8eb16db8cdb7c" already present on machine
2022-03-24 19:52:34
Started container lb-port-10157
2022-03-24 19:52:33
Add eth0 [172.16.0.159/16] from ix-net
2022-03-24 19:52:33
Created container lb-port-10157
2022-03-24 19:52:21
Container image "rancher/klipper-lb:v0.1.2" already present on machine
2022-03-24 19:52:20
Add eth0 [172.16.0.158/16] from ix-net
Successfully assigned ix-unmanic/unmanic-678468fdd9-qkmw7 to ix-truenas
2022-03-24 19:52:14
Successfully provisioned volume pvc-2844e19f-bea3-40bb-8b9b-55571889fdc4
2022-03-24 19:52:14
Successfully provisioned volume pvc-236ff968-4690-4d2c-95dd-c39aa518e117
0/1 nodes are available: 1 pod has unbound immediate PersistentVolumeClaims.
2022-03-24 19:52:11
waiting for a volume to be created, either by external provisioner "zfs.csi.openebs.io" or manually created by system administrator
2022-03-24 19:52:11
waiting for a volume to be created, either by external provisioner "zfs.csi.openebs.io" or manually created by system administrator
Successfully assigned ix-unmanic/svclb-unmanic-zpn6s to ix-truenas
2022-03-24 19:52:11
External provisioner is provisioning volume for claim "ix-unmanic/unmanic-config"
2022-03-24 19:52:11
External provisioner is provisioning volume for claim "ix-unmanic/unmanic-remote"
0/1 nodes are available: 1 pod has unbound immediate PersistentVolumeClaims.
2022-03-24 19:52:11
Created pod: svclb-unmanic-zpn6s
2022-03-24 19:52:11
Created pod: unmanic-678468fdd9-qkmw7

Application Logs

2022-03-25T01:32:14.488700306Z [s6-init] making user provided files available at /var/run/s6/etc...exited 0.
2022-03-25T01:32:14.550947569Z [s6-init] ensuring user provided files have correct perms...exited 0.
2022-03-25T01:32:14.552940344Z [fix-attrs.d] applying ownership & permissions fixes...
2022-03-25T01:32:14.554105585Z [fix-attrs.d] done.
2022-03-25T01:32:14.555239503Z [cont-init.d] executing container initialization scripts...
2022-03-25T01:32:14.557410900Z [cont-init.d] 01-envfile: executing... 
2022-03-25T01:32:14.567260697Z [cont-init.d] 01-envfile: exited 0.
2022-03-25T01:32:14.569197996Z [cont-init.d] 01-migrations: executing... 
2022-03-25T01:32:14.571155506Z [migrations] started
2022-03-25T01:32:14.571214259Z [migrations] no migrations found
2022-03-25T01:32:14.571954564Z [cont-init.d] 01-migrations: exited 0.
2022-03-25T01:32:14.574068656Z [cont-init.d] 02-tamper-check: executing... 
2022-03-25T01:32:14.599236690Z [cont-init.d] 02-tamper-check: exited 0.
2022-03-25T01:32:14.601260199Z [cont-init.d] 10-adduser: executing... 
2022-03-25T01:32:15.331534197Z 
2022-03-25T01:32:15.331606503Z -------------------------------------
2022-03-25T01:32:15.331625446Z           _         ()
2022-03-25T01:32:15.331641146Z          | |  ___   _    __
2022-03-25T01:32:15.331656430Z          | | / __| | |  /  \
2022-03-25T01:32:15.331689386Z          | | \__ \ | | | () |
2022-03-25T01:32:15.331707129Z          |_| |___/ |_|  \__/
2022-03-25T01:32:15.331722773Z 
2022-03-25T01:32:15.331738042Z 
2022-03-25T01:32:15.331753417Z Brought to you by linuxserver.io
2022-03-25T01:32:15.331768535Z -------------------------------------
2022-03-25T01:32:15.331792900Z 
2022-03-25T01:32:15.331809401Z To support LSIO projects visit:
2022-03-25T01:32:15.331824843Z https://www.linuxserver.io/donate/
2022-03-25T01:32:15.331840127Z -------------------------------------
2022-03-25T01:32:15.331855308Z GID/UID
2022-03-25T01:32:15.331878678Z -------------------------------------
2022-03-25T01:32:15.336971391Z 
2022-03-25T01:32:15.337008882Z User uid:    1000
2022-03-25T01:32:15.337026141Z User gid:    1000
2022-03-25T01:32:15.337041600Z -------------------------------------
2022-03-25T01:32:15.337057130Z 
2022-03-25T01:32:15.345449385Z [cont-init.d] 10-adduser: exited 0.
2022-03-25T01:32:15.346730135Z [cont-init.d] 20-config: executing... 
2022-03-25T01:32:15.351750674Z **** (permissions_config) Setting run user uid=1000(abc) gid=1000(abc)  ****
2022-03-25T01:32:15.368053077Z usermod: no changes
2022-03-25T01:32:15.368101768Z **** (permissions_config) Setting permissions ****
2022-03-25T01:32:15.373219769Z **** (permissions_config) Adding run user to video group ****
2022-03-25T01:32:15.375783856Z [cont-init.d] 20-config: exited 0.
2022-03-25T01:32:15.377252635Z [cont-init.d] 30-patch-nvidia: executing... 
2022-03-25T01:32:15.382591993Z [cont-init.d] 30-patch-nvidia: exited 0.
2022-03-25T01:32:15.383599100Z [cont-init.d] 60-custom-setup-script: executing... 
2022-03-25T01:32:15.389166706Z [cont-init.d] 60-custom-setup-script: exited 0.
2022-03-25T01:32:15.390572346Z [cont-init.d] 90-custom-folders: executing... 
2022-03-25T01:32:15.397991782Z [cont-init.d] 90-custom-folders: exited 0.
2022-03-25T01:32:15.399251957Z [cont-init.d] 99-custom-scripts: executing... 
2022-03-25T01:32:15.410475379Z [custom-init] no custom files found exiting...
2022-03-25T01:32:15.410766419Z [cont-init.d] 99-custom-scripts: exited 0.
2022-03-25T01:32:15.411491991Z [cont-init.d] done.
2022-03-25T01:32:15.412487270Z [services.d] starting services
2022-03-25T01:32:15.419504375Z [services.d] done.
2022-03-25T01:32:16.030981305Z 2022-03-24T20:32:16:INFO:Unmanic.UnmanicLogger - Debug logging disabled
2022-03-25T01:32:16.031039440Z 2022-03-24T20:32:16:INFO:Unmanic.UnmanicLogger - Initialising file logger. All further logs should output to the 'unmanic.log' file

Application Configuration

Screenshot_20220324_204357 Screenshot_20220324_204352 Screenshot_20220324_204343 Screenshot_20220324_204337 Screenshot_20220324_204327 Screenshot_20220324_204320

Describe the bug

Currently unmanic is unable to scan files inside of the /library. I have confirmed that unmanic can see the files and is being owned by abc. EX: drwxr-xr-x 3 abc abc 6 Mar 17 23:10 FILENAME id uid=0(root) gid=0(root) groups=0(root),568,1000(abc)

Additionally the remote link functionality does not work.

To Reproduce

Add library folder as hostpath to the application library section. Start unmanic. Click on scan library. Nothing happens

For the remote link. Go to settings -> link -> add remote link. Add the remote device. remote device workers do not show in main tab.

Expected Behavior

Unmanic should get a list of files for it to check.

For the remote link. Unmanic should show idle remote worker tabs in main window.

Screenshots

![Uploading Screenshot_20220324_204725.png…]()

Additional Context

I know i should make separate issues but im lazy, sorry. The /library folder shows folders and files as it should but unmanic doesn't scan them.

I've read and agree with the following

stavros-k commented 2 years ago

If the files are owned by the correct user 1000 (abc ), and unmanic can see the files. It's most likely an unmanic's problem. Keep in mind that unmanic did a major update some days ago, adding a ton of features and a big refactor of it's code base.

With that said, check you configured it to scan the files. either manual or automatically.

Anyway it's on my todo list to check that the app is ok after this major update. But it's on the lower end of my priority

stavros-k commented 2 years ago

Also, if remote machine is added, means it's connected. If the workers does not show up. It's again an unmanic's problem

Just tried the app, my library scanned fine. Our side is working as it should.

If there is a proven bug on our side, please re-open a ticket. If you need help setting the app itself use discord channel #software-general

truecharts-admin commented 1 year ago

This issue is locked to prevent necro-posting on closed issues. Please create a new issue or contact staff on discord of the problem persists